作为一名程序员,数据库连接是我们在开发过程中必不可少的一环。而在JSP开发中,数据库连接架包的使用更是至关重要。今天,我就来给大家详细讲解一下JSP数据库连接架包的实例教程,让你从入门到实践,轻松掌握数据库连接技术。

1.

在JSP开发中,我们通常会使用一些数据库连接架包来简化数据库操作。常见的数据库连接架包有:JDBC、MySQL Connector/J、Oracle JDBC、SQL Server JDBC等。今天,我们就以JDBC和MySQL Connector/J为例,为大家讲解JSP数据库连接架包的实例教程。

JSP数据库连接架包实例教程从入门到方法  第1张

2. 准备工作

在开始之前,我们需要做一些准备工作:

1. 安装Java开发环境:确保你的电脑上已经安装了Java开发环境,如JDK、IDE(如Eclipse、IntelliJ IDEA)等。

2. 安装数据库:根据需要,安装相应的数据库,如MySQL、Oracle、SQL Server等。

3. 获取数据库连接架包:下载并解压JDBC和MySQL Connector/J架包。

3. JDBC简介

JDBC(Java Database Connectivity)是Java语言中用于访问数据库的一种标准API。它允许Java程序与各种数据库进行交互。以下是JDBC的基本结构:

组件作用
Driver数据库驱动程序,负责将JDBC调用转换为数据库特定的调用。
Connection数据库连接,用于与数据库进行交互。
StatementSQL语句执行器,用于执行SQL语句。
ResultSet结果集,用于存储SQL查询的结果。

4. MySQL Connector/J简介

MySQL Connector/J是MySQL官方提供的JDBC驱动程序,用于Java程序访问MySQL数据库。以下是MySQL Connector/J的基本使用方法:

1. 导入架包:在Java项目中,导入MySQL Connector/J架包。

2. 建立连接:使用DriverManager.getConnection()方法建立数据库连接。

3. 执行SQL语句:使用Connection对象创建Statement或PreparedStatement对象,并执行SQL语句。

4. 关闭连接:执行完操作后,关闭连接、语句和结果集。

5. 实例教程

下面,我们以一个简单的实例来讲解JSP数据库连接架包的使用。

实例:查询数据库中的用户信息

1. 创建数据库和表

```sql

CREATE DATABASE mydb;

USE mydb;

CREATE TABLE users (

id INT PRIMARY KEY AUTO_INCREMENT,

username VARCHAR(50),

password VARCHAR(50)

);

```

2. 编写JSP代码

```jsp

<%@ page contentType="